Soup Diet Info: Foods to Be Eaten to Become Healthy


Summer is in and it’s time to whip out those bathing suits and head off for the seaside. But this doesn’t imply that you’ll punish yourself by not eating simply to get a lean body for the summer season. One of the biggest tricks to effective weight loss is to consume fewer calories . The fewer calories you eat, the less your body must burn.The single easiest way to cut calories from your summer season diet program, authorities say, is to load up on nature’s bounty. Make the most out of the freshest fruit and veggies from your neighborhood market. Aside from them being low on calories, fruits and vegetables possess nutritional vitamins, minerals, herbal antioxidants, and fiber. Here are a few good ideas on what you could consume to get you fit in time for that ocean holiday:

Watermelons and Pears. These two fruits are two of the “juiciest” fruits that are fantastic for summer time. Who doesn’t like diving into a crisp, juicy piece of watermelon when it is very hot outdoors? Adding to that, watermelons are created from half water. It’s the perfect way to savor something simple and satisfy your thirst the nutritious way. Other than that, understand that drinking water, regardless how uninteresting it is, aids quite a bit in effective weight loss. Individuals who basically stay hydrated more frequent drop some weight more quickly than those who don’t!

Fruit- centered desserts. If you find yourself craving for something sugary, beat the temptation to seizea chocolate bar and have some fruit- centered desserts instead like banana splits with fat free soft serve, frozen yoghurts or nice frozen cherries. Say Goodbye To high- calorie desserts and choose these naturally nice pleasures. Low calorie beverages. Wherever possible, steer clear of carbonated soda pops and alcoholic beverages. It may be hard, indeed, because sodas and spirits seem to be the ideal refreshments to start enjoying the summer season. But this is actually not recommended because these beverages can certainly slow down your metabolism , making it tough for your body to burn the body fat.

Chilled soups. Chilled soups are essentially low on calories so they are great if you wish to drop a few pounds. Furthermore they’re delightful, as well. Chilled soups like gazpacho or cucumber-dill which contain a number of chunky vegetables are fantastic options. Research indicates that a low- calorie, broth- based soup at the beginning of the meal will fill you so you eat less during meals. When you certainly consider it, soups (with vegetables) have been terrific to lose weight because they have plenty of Dietary fiber that help purge the fat out of your system. There are now lots of eating plans that motivate the intake of fruits and vegetables- one of the most familiar is the Cabbage Soup Diet .

The soup diet recipe though is advisable to be accomplished for a course of 7 days only as it requires you to consume essentially just a few vegetables and broth. So even if you need to shed the weight, having the nutritious fruit and veggies along with it should never be neglected. Your body still needs the vitamins and minerals to keep healthy and balanced. Metabolic Finisher for Fat Loss and Stress Relief Using Only a Medicine Ball


Metabolic Finisher for Fat Loss and Stress Relief

Are you looking for a proven way to accelerate your metabolism for fat loss, increase your endurance level, and relieve a little stress in the process?  Then incorporating this Metabolic Finisher into your workout is the way to go.

A Metabolic Finisher is an intense exercise or series of exercises performed at the end of the workout that’s designed to ensure you’ve burnt every last ounce of fat and calories.

Medicine Throw Ball Complex:

If you’ve got a rubber medicine ball (3-5kg) and a wall to hurl it at, get ready to blow off some steam and give this a shot!

Purpose:

Improve upper body and core power endurance. This Metabolic Finisher is great for upper-body conditioning, especially since so much of conditioning is typically lower body dominant. Great for boxers, kick-boxers, MMA fighters, or anyone who wants a strong core.

7 Awesome Medicine Ball Drills to Increase Speed!!


Medicine ball drills are overlooked by many coaches in general. Even when coaches do implement medicine ball training, they only look at it as upper body and core strengthening. There are so many other facets to medicine ball training.

Let’s take a look at the many ways in which medicine ball training can increase speed.

Here is a quick tutorial on physics. Newton’s third law of action reaction basically states that when ever there is a force applied, there is an equal and opposite reaction meeting that force. This is the concept I use medicine ball training to train for lateral speed and quickness, and actually it is great for deceleration training.

When an athlete applies quick and powerful force to the medicine ball to throw it, the feet must be the other end of the equation that counteract that force the arms are applying to the ball. When an athlete is in a athletic stance and throws the ball across the body, this action forces the legs to simulate the actual forces that occur during deceleration from lateral movement.
To test the theory that the position of the legs and the angles that are used during lateral deceleration are important, have the athlete throw the ball sideways across the body with the feet in a narrow stance (under the hips). You will see that lower power levels exist due to not having the proper leg angles. Also, you may even see the athlete lean or stumble away from the direction of the throw. This is due to the action reaction forces- because the feet are so narrow they can’t meet the action with an appropriate reaction and maintain balance and produce higher power.
Now I have talked about the importance of using the medicine to train for lateral speed, but I also like to use it for jumping and for transferring lower body power through the upper body and out the arms. Listed below are 7 fantastic drills that will improve speed and lower and upper body power.
1) Forward Shuffle (toward partner) and quick push pass:
1. The athlete will be in an athletic stance facing to the right.
2. The ball will be held at chest level with elbows out to the side.
3. The athlete will shuffle 2-3 hard shuffle to the left and immediately thrust open the hips and push pass the ball the partner on one bounce. (don’t catch in the air due to injury potential)
Keys to watch for:
• The athlete doesn’t fall forward or lean forward causing a loss of balance.
• The athlete crosses the body with the throw rather than the hips opening up first to allow the throw to be more powerful and fluid.
• Make sure the athlete stays down in an athletic stance through out the exercise.
• Sets and reps:
o Beginners perform 1-2 sets of 5 reps on each side with 1:00 minute rest between sets.
o More advanced athlete performs 2-3 sets of 6-8 on each side with 2:00 break between each set.
2) Backward Shuffle (away from partner) and quick push pass:
1. The set up for this drill is the same as the first drill except the athlete will be shuffling away from the partner.
2. If the athlete is facing the right side and will be shuffling to the right, the right foot will be the planting leg while the left leg is the power leg during the shuffle.
3. When the athlete stops the angle of the right leg needs to be able to stop the body and apply quick force to get the hips through to make the throw.

Why You Should Use Medicine Balls in Your Cardio Workouts – Part 2


Last time, we looked at how medicine balls could help you build a strong, rugged, and “ripped” midsection, and how they could be used with some basic, simple exercises, to create intense and athletic versions of those same movements to get you into better shape that much quicker.  This time, we’ll look at how to turn these into true cardio workouts, and how to create ‘super exercises’ that will accomplish as many as 3 different things at once! Med balls can also be used to do some pretty intense exercises that just aren’t possible without them.  For example, the Woodchopper (as described by Coach John Davies).  Start standing upright, holding the med ball at your waist.  Bring the med ball out to arms’ length in front of you, squat down, and touch the ball to the ground.  Immediately explode up, jumping up into the air, and bringing the med ball to overhead.  Land, reset, and repeat.  Keep going until doom sounds like a good idea. For amazing cardio, string together several exercises into complexes (like was mentioned with the abdominal exercises).  Pick 3-5 exercises, and perform 5-10 reps of each exercise back to back without resting between exercises.  Once you finally complete an entire circuit, rest 1-3 mins, and repeat.  A sample complex might be: -Woodchoppers x 10 -Pushups (both hands on med ball) x 10 -Med Ball Slams x 10 -Squats (holding med ball overhead) x 10 -Situps holding med ball x 10 Another great thing about med balls is how you can add different elements into one exercise, making an almost “super movement”.  Let’s look at an example. First, take the lunge.  That is a pretty tough move.  Let’s add a dynamic (explosive) – and in turn, cardiovascular – element, by turning them into jumping lunges.  Doing these, you get into lunge position, jump into the air, switch feet in mid air, land, and repeat with the other leg.  Now, add another element by holding a med ball.  The exercise just got harder.  But, let’s go a step further, by adding a med ball twist.  Every time you land with the left foot forward, twist to the left so that you’re facing left, and the ball is pointed left.  Everytime you land with the right foot forward, reverse it. Try that for 10-12 reps each leg and see if you’re not huffing and puffing. Many Uses of the Medicine Ball


Fitness experts have become very creative in finding new ways to use the med ball. It  is such a versatile piece of exercise equipment that it can be used in basically all kinds of training. It is especially useful in home gyms when used in circuit training programs. In these types of programs you are moving from one exercise to another in an attempt to get a complete workout. As you transition from one exercise to another, the medicine ball is the perfect complement to most of the other exercise equipment that you have.

Unlike in the past, you can find medicine balls in pretty much any sports store. Also known as med balls or fitness balls, they come in all sizes. Men tend to use the heavier ones as a complement to their weight building program. Women tend to use the lighter ones in conjunction with their fitness routines.

The medicine ball is a common fixture in many sports and training programs across the U.S. And that’s because it is such a versatile piece of equipment. For example, most sports usually require that the athlete be capable of explosive actions. This means that the muscles must be able to contract and the nerves must be able to react at a fast pace. One way of training these muscles and nerves to do just that is to have the athlete perform plyometrics exercises. These exercises are designed to train the muscles to use their power in bursts of rapid explosions.

For instance, weight lifters and body builders have worked hard to train their muscles to be very powerful and to lift enormous weights. But, the sport of weight lifting, does not require that the athlete be fast.

But with athletes like foot ball players, the goal is a bit different. Especially for those that play on the offensive and defensive lines. Like weight lifters, they are required to have a lot of strength. And they all perform weight lifting to build up that strength. But, football players are also required to have explosive speed when coming off of the ball or trying to get to the opposing quarterback.

Trainers build exercises utilizing the medicine ball in an effort to assist in building that explosive speed. A football player who trains with weights but without the medicine ball, or a piece of equipment that does the same function, would surely be strong and powerful. But he would most likely be too slow to play in the NFL.

Those who have managed to put together their own home gym, will find that the medicine ball has so many potential uses in exercise routines that it can legitimately be considered as a core piece of fitness equipment. This is especially true if you play sports. The endurance and strength that you will need for many sports can only be helped by integrating a medicine ball into your training routine.

Get Lean Toned & Muscular in 2010 With the Medicine Ball at Home Workout


Hi everyone and welcome to the ultimate total body medicine ball workout!  Forget about spending thousands of dollars on personal home gym equipment, personal trainers or gym memberships.  Workouts like the total body medicine ball workout can get you in great shape without spending all that money and can be done in the comfort of your own home!

The medicine ball total body workout is a quick workout that you can do at home and is very effective at helping you burn fat, build muscle and muscular endurance and get you that ripped, lean athletic body you are looking for.  This is a circuit training workout so you are going to want to do one exercise and quickly move on to the next exercise.  The workout is comprised of 7 exercises with high reps, but in order to do it, you are going to need a medicine ball.

Advanced participants can use a 12 to 15 pound medicine ball while beginners or intermediates can use a 4, 6 or 8 pound medicine ball.  The goal of this workout is to complete it as fast as possible, without sacrificing good form.  Therefore you are going to want to move from exercise to exercise, taking as few breaks as possible and ideally taking none at all.

Exercise 1:  Rolling Push Ups

20 Reps

Exercise 2:  Tricep Push Ups

20 Reps

Exercise 3:  Shoulder Tosses

15 Reps

Exercise 4:  Wiper & Crunch Ab Combo

10 Wiper Reps & 25 Crunch Reps

Exercise 5:  Lunge With Overhead Twists

10 Reps per Leg

Exercise 6:  Medicine Ball RDL’s

10 Reps per Leg

Exercise 7:  Curl Catches

30 Reps

As you can see, this is a total body workout that can be done quite quickly and is ideal if you want a quick workout in the morning at home, or before you hit the beach or go out to the bar at night.  It will get you a great pump all through your body and give you a cardio workout and burn off a lot of fat all at the same time.

This type of circuit training is the best and most efficient way to workout if you want to get ripped, lean, muscular in order to build a solid athletic physique.  Not only does it make you look good, its helps you athletically as well and you will notice that your endurance in sports will significantly increase.
